Problem w/ 50 Watt Chinese Laser - USB Ports
Hey there! I am new to CNCZone. I have searched all over this site to see if someone had a similar problem to mine, but I am not seeing anything. I am really hoping someone can help!
I just bought a 50 watt Chinese laser from Ebay and it got here on Wednesday (pic below). I have run through aligning the lasers, etc and everything from that standpoint seems fine.
The issue I am having is that my laptop does not seem to recognize the machine at all, to the point that it does not even know I plugged anything in. I also tried plugging in a thumb drive to the Udrive port, but when I try to pull up a file from there, it says no files found.
I have opened up the side and used a new USB cable and gone straight from my laptop into the board where they all plug in to. So, I know it's not a bad cable somewhere in the chain.
When I emailed the seller, he told me it's because I have a laptop and that I should try a desktop computer instead. While I have no experience with Chinese lasers, I have been in IT for almost 15 years, and I don't see how changing from a laptop to a desktop could have any impact. If I had a desktop computer, I would try it...but, my house has 4 laptops and no desktops!
Does anyone have any insight into what this could be, or has anyone else run into this? The only thing I can think is either that the board itself is bad, or does this laser not work with Windows 8 or something?

I wanted to post an update, in case anyone else ran into this same issue.
The problem was that I was running Windows 8, which the machine is not capable of running on...which is why my computer didn't even know that I plugged anything in. As soon as I plugged it into a Windows 7 or Windows XP machine, the "install new hardware" prompt came up as it should.
